A 22-year-old from Cheltenham who vowed to complete a marathon for every year of 2025 finished his 49th run this week at Liverpool’s Lime Street station.

Tommy Greenhouse, who this summer graduated from a degree in sport rehabilitation, has taken on the year-long challenge to raise money for 52 different mental health charities.

He ran loops around Anfield stadium this week to raise money for PTSD UK, a charity which raises awareness on the causes, symptoms, and treatments available for Post Traumatic Stress Disorder. It is the only UK charity for everyone affected by the condition.

By the end of the year, he will have run across all 48 English counties as well as completing four additional marathons outside of England, in Cardiff, Istanbul, Giza and Dubai. Along the way he is telling the story of his struggles, spreading the message that life can get better.

Tommy said: “I used to suffer really badly. I’ve tried to take my own life several times and when it came to choosing different mental health charities, PTSD was massive for me because, although it wasn’t confirmed, I used to experience quite bad flashbacks of some of my attempts, so I empathise so badly with the condition.”

He added: “Even though, I still get my down days, I still get low sometimes, I still relapse, but we are all still capable of amazing things even if you are not mentally there at the moment. It will come, you’ve just got to keep on going, and when it does come, it will feel so sweet.”

Tommy said he hopes that completing this challenge will help other people who are currently struggling to find their purpose and feel confident to talk about their problems.

Finishing his marathon at Lime Street station, Tommy said how good it feels to be nearing the end of his 52-week challenge.

With only three more marathons to go; Cardiff, Greater London and lastly his home town of Cheltenham, the finishing line is now in sight.

Tommy said that the experience had been hard, but that he is determined to see it through: “I will keep going and I can finish it.”
